Sony DADC Continues Major Investment In London-Based Blu-ray Disc Authoring Facility
Sony DADC, a leading disc and digital solution provider, announced the completion of its latest investment round in Blu-ray Disc authoring and mastering facilities at its London office.
A global player in the media creation industry with creative facilities on every continent, Sony DADC has now created Europe's best resourced and most advanced Blu-ray Disc authoring and mastering cluster comprising of the London facility working closely with its Salzburg Blu-ray Disc authoring centre.
Alongside the format's stunning High Definition video and audio capabilities, Sony DADC continues to invest in the evolution of its BD-Live authoring resources. This sophisticated interactivity palette blends Blu-ray seamlessly with internet connectivity and transforms the home entertainment experience from passive viewing to totally immersive interactivity.
It enables movie fans to access a rich diversity of added value content and communicate with the movie's makers, the studio and other committed fans through specially developed web-based portals.
Neil Bottrill, Head of DigitalWorks Authoring & Post-Production at Sony DADC's London office, said: "With its unprecedented picture and sound quality together with the rapidly developing BD-Live, Blu-ray is revolutionising the European home entertainment industry. Already, Blu-ray accounts for more of our revenue than DVD projects. In just 12 months, we have seen our Blu-ray authoring business grow by more than ten times in both volume and value."
Delivering a fast-track Blu-ray Disc production facility for its clients, Sony DADC has invested heavily in HD production equipment, which covers the entire creative process from HDCAM-SR format High Definition tape decks to specialist encoding systems and authoring software.
As a result of this investment, Sony DADC has all the necessary BD production facilities in-house and can turn around projects faster than any other facility operating in Europe.
Bottrill added: "Thanks to all the facilities mentioned, Sony DADC can offer a seamless One-Stop-Shop service for Blu-ray customers: from content creation, through authoring, mastering and production through to direct-to-retail shipments. So our clients just need to focus on sales and marketing and do not have to worry about handing the title over from one supplier to the other."
Sony DADC's rapidly growing Blu-ray client list includes 2Entertain, Sony Pictures Home Entertainment, Icon, Entertainment Film, ITV DVD, Optimum, Showbox Media Group Limited, Metrodome, Artificial Eye, Twentieth Century Fox, Universal Music and Eagle Vision.
2008 is the year when Blu-ray moved significantly into the interactive space through the implementation of its unique BD-Live system and when BD-Live capacities were simultaneously rolled out at Sony DADC facilities in US, Europe and China. With a wide range of consumer electronics manufacturers - such as Sony, Panasonic, Sharp and Pioneer launching BD-Live players this autumn, the movie studios are looking at this facility with interest.
Neil Bottrill explained: "Today it is the format's exceptional picture and sound quality that turn consumers on to Blu-ray but in the future we will see BD-Live becoming an increasingly important element in the entertainment proposition.
"Already we can offer the European market's most advanced BD-Live production facility. In the future, our plan is to stay ahead of the market by bringing more of these facilities, resources and people in-house within the London team."
